@CzarChasm , and anyone else who was interested in voting for the Terminator design in the next public design poll, we have an update for you to provide some input on. Since the last time you nomiated the Terminator design we started discussing it in the sanctum. I was thinking about just running it in house rather then wait for it to win a public vote. As that discussion heated up, we had 3 different factions pulling the design in three different directions and as a result we determined that one lunchbox design wasn't going to fit the bill here. One group wanted to be able to field an army of killer robots, one group wanted to field the "hunter" Terminator from T1 that was sent back in time to kill a specific target while blending in with the past, and one group wanted a re-programmed "protector" Terminator from T2 that worked more like a body guard. So what was one Terminator design has since morphed into 3 different card ideas.
I'll share where we last left the design at here in the public with you all now. Some issues like the name and secret identity are still trying to be worked out so that you can draft them all into the same army. We need CzarChasm to decide which one of the 3 card idea he wants for his nomination this round. The long term plan is to hopefully get all 3 done at some point, but we will only be doing one at a time, so pick which one most appeals to you for the first foray into this franchise. Here is a 3 card approach for the T-800. Shock Troops: NAME = T-800 SECRET IDENTITY = none or SKYNET EXO-SKELETON SPECIES = ANDROID UNIQUENESS = UNCOMMON HERO CLASS = ? PERSONALITY = RUTHLESS SIZE/HEIGHT = MEDIUM 5 LIFE = 4 MOVE = 4 RANGE = 6 ATTACK = 3 DEFENSE = 4 POINTS = 170-180? SYNCHRONIZED ASSAULT After revealing an Order Marker on this card and instead of taking a normal turn with this Skynet Exo-Skeleton, you may do one of the following: - Take an immediate turn with this figure and one other Android Hero you control in which they may only move. If you do, both figures add 2 to their move. You may choose which figure to move first. - Take an immediate turn with this figure and one other Android Hero you control in which they may only attack. If you do, both figures may add 1 to their normal attack. You may choose which figure attacks first. TOUGH When rolling defense dice against a normal attack, the Skynet Exo-Skeleton always adds one automatic shield to whatever is rolled. This is the figure we are considering for the shock troop exo-skelton ones: For the Arnold Terminator we were going to slightly modify this guy: Bad guy "hunter" Terminator: NAME = T-800 SECRET IDENTITY = SKYNET TERMINATOR SPECIES = ANDROID UNIQUENESS = UNIQUE HERO CLASS = HUNTER PERSONALITY = RELENTLESS SIZE/HEIGHT = MEDIUM 5 LIFE = 5 MOVE = 4 RANGE = 6 ATTACK = 4 DEFENSE = 4 POINTS = 190-210? INFILTRATION MODEL At the start of the game, before rolling for initiative, you may roll a single combat die. If you roll a skull, you may move the Skynet Terminator up to four spaces and roll the die again. You may continue rolling and moving the Skynet Terminator until you do not roll a skull. TERMINATION PROGRAMMING At the start of the game, choose an opponent’s Unique Hero for Termination Programming. Immediately after the chosen Hero moves one or more spaces, you may move the Skynet Terminator up to two spaces. UNSTOPPABLE RESILIENCE If the Skynet Terminator would receive one or more wounds, ignore one of those wounds. Good Guy "protector" Terminator: NAME = T-800 SECRET IDENTITY = REPROGRAMMED TERMINATOR SPECIES = ANDROID UNIQUENESS = UNIQUE HERO CLASS = GUARDIAN PERSONALITY = DEVOTED SIZE/HEIGHT = MEDIUM 5 LIFE = 5 MOVE = 4 RANGE = 6 ATTACK = 4 DEFENSE = 4 POINTS = 210-220? PROTECTION PROGRAMMING At the start of the game, choose another Medium or Small Unique Hero you control. Immediately after an Order Marker is revealed on the chosen Hero’s card, you may move the Reprogrammed Terminator up to four spaces. AUTO SHOTGUN SPECIAL ATTACK Range 4. Attack 3. Choose a figure to attack. Any figures adjacent to the chosen figure are also affected by this special attack. The Reprogrammed Terminator only needs a clear sight shot at the chosen figure. Roll attack dice once for all affected figures. Each figure rolls defense dice separately. The Reprogrammed Terminator cannot be affected by this special attack. When the Reprogrammed Terminator attacks with this special attack, it may attack one additional time. UNSTOPPABLE RESILIENCE If the Reprogrammed Terminator would receive one or more wounds, ignore one of those wounds. Synchronize Assault is something I created for one of the IG-88 droids in HoSS, just adapted to fit here. Since they are uncommon heroes and most often seen in multiples, it seems like a good way to represent a group of them spreading out and attacking their foes as part of a larger programmed strategy. Haven't really looked at the list of current Androids they could work with in C3G yet to see if anything pops out as really good, but based on my testing of this power in HoSS where they could do the same thing with Soulborgs like Q9, I don't foresee there being a problem. |
